Output 61b15ffeda623714c754f0b1470faf4ef481e4065a0f906868a4f3fe45be4765:0

value
343000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d42d20cce9cc2e64188120a9deddef782d0324f7 OP_EQUALVERIFY OP_CHECKSIG
address
1LLtKE4nirbxvbgZGSqSKLfQpZtxuFwEh8
transaction
61b15ffeda623714c754f0b1470faf4ef481e4065a0f906868a4f3fe45be4765
spent
true